Welcome! I am an Assistant Professor of English Composition and a Composition Coordinator at Youngstown State University. My experience and specialties are in writing program administration, composition theory and pedagogies, student success programs, writing centers, and supporting diverse student populations. As a teacher, researcher, and administrator, I focus on the transition to college, particularly through student engagement in composition courses and success programs. I have ten years of experience teaching composition and four years of administrative leadership experience in writing programs and writing centers.
My most current research project examines student transitional experiences to higher education in summer bridge programs. My work has been published in Composition Studies, Composition Forum and Community Literacy Journal. I co-founded and taught in the Prison Education Project, which provides opportunities for incarcerated students in the Arizona State Prison to take first-year writing courses.
